I have been eating a LOT of glycine lately... In my coffee with coconut cream and sugar, and I've also been making a homemade jello with blended fruit, multiple scoops of gelatin and then little bits of the fruit suspended in the jello. It is incredibly satisfying...

The glycine is absolutely improving my ability to recover from all the biking and hiking and walking that I do. I no longer have any sore or puffy muscles, no more water retention after more intense bursts of exercise. I do like to eat a lot so I have invented this Jello meal because I like that there is a lot of it.

Another thing I've been experimenting with and I am not sure how it will go over in this form, is defatted peanut protein and almond powders.. the methionine is quite low and the fats have been removed. I will make a paste of these alongside some mashed strawberries or with some sliced bananas on top and it is outrageously delicious and filling.

During the last month I did a huge amount of backpacking and I avoided all of the trail mixes and other backpacking type foods that contain nuts and polyunsaturated fats. I ate a lot of oatmeal with coconut flakes and gelatin mixed in, dried fruit, beef jerky, and for dinner I would have gluten-free dehydrated backpacking meals heavy on the rice...
